赤と黒 - The Red & The Black - UNIQUE - 60x50cm

It is midnight—when the world holds its breath and the air hums with quiet alert. A girl stands in the dark, her hair deep as ink, her red eyes glowing like embers. Beside her, a salamander mirrors her gaze—its slick skin black as night, its eyes burning the same crimson fire. Around them, the forest stirs: an owl calls, water murmurs in the distance, shadows breathe. Are they watching us—or waiting for us to see what lies within their world?

Original artwork on canvas in a Manga style. Created exclusively with acrylics, with a felt-tip pen used on top for the meticulous line work. An additional 5 cm has been added on each side to allow for stretching. Delivered with a hand-signed certificate of authenticity. Part of creative collaboration with Anna Dart. Shipped carefully rolled (without a frame) in a protective tube for a safe delivery. The artwork might appear differently in photos, depending on the camera settings. The colors are very bright and beautiful.

ABOUT THE ARTIST:

Roger Haus [1984] has been delivering the wow factor in his work for over a decade. Trained at La Llotja Art and Crafts Academy in Barcelona, one of Spain's oldest and most prestigious art institutions, where renowned artists like Picasso and Miró honed their craft, Roger Haus later continued his training at IDEP Academy, known for its strong emphasis on technological integration. Meanwhile, passionate about manga, street art, and photography, he filled the streets with graffiti and his notebooks with daily illustrations. In 2015, Roger expressed an interest in the use of generative networks for his drawings and paintings, making him one of the early pioneers. Today, his art has been exhibited in the USA, Canada, France, Spain, Switzerland, Japan, and South Korea, making big waves on social media. Roger has collaborated with prominent institutions, including Universal Music, the Picasso Museum, CaixaForum, and the Joan Miró Foundation. A surrealist at heart, Roger embraces automatism for the spontaneous expression, inviting you to step a little closer into an exciting world of infinite possibilities.
